Common Amarr Garage Door Problems We Solve in August
- Torsion spring fatigue from extreme heat cycles. Amarr’s standard .225-wire springs in the 95205 area typically fail 30–40% sooner than manufacturer ratings predict. The 105°F+ August garage interior accelerates metal fatigue, and we’ve replaced springs on Amarr Heritage doors that were barely four years old.
- Opener board failure in unventilated garages. Amarr doors paired with older Genie or LiftMaster openers — common in east Stockton’s 1960s ranches — cook their logic boards by mid-July. The door itself is fine; the opener quits responding to remotes. We test the full chain before quoting replacement.
- Bottom seal deformation and pest intrusion. Amarr’s vinyl seals soften and flatten against hot concrete, leaving gaps that let August’s field mice and insects migrate in. We upgrade to reinforced rubber with aluminum retainer strips that survive the heat.
- Low-headroom track binding. August’s post-WWII and 1970s tract garages were framed with 8–9 feet of total height and minimal headroom. Standard Amarr torsion hardware won’t clear the opener rail. We keep low-headroom conversion kits and quick-turn brackets in stock for these exact August frames.
- Security hardware corrosion from tule fog humidity. Amarr’s standard slide bolts and exterior lock hardware rust through winter fog season after summer baking strips protective coatings. We replace with stainless or zinc-plated equivalents and can install door-jamb reinforcement kits during the same visit.

Amarr Models & Products We Service in August
We work on the full Amarr residential line: the Stratford steel carriage-house series, Lincoln traditional short- and long-panel doors, Oak Summit entry-level steel, Hillcrest decorative overlay models, and the discontinued Heritage and Designer collections still running in older August homes. Our parts inventory covers Amarr-specific bottom fixtures, stamped-steel hinges, nylon rollers, and torsion spring assemblies calibrated to Amarr’s door weights.
